你查询的IP:[116.4.216.20]  地理位置:中国–广东–东莞

最新查询159.226.35.245 123.196.177.9 117.75.167.202 121.171.16.7 221.203.205.41 123.52.142.80 222.16.194.217 114.80.218.20 123.64.149.13 116.4.216.20 61.8.160.53 119.96.238.25 58.32.209.91 202.173.224.162 123.244.22.231 119.248.208.213 116.56.176.208 203.95.49.101 119.78.41.53 203.79.90.207 203.161.192.214 60.255.231.195 202.127.112.29 116.194.167.169 202.180.128.186 61.28.87.246 202.136.208.247 60.247.34.114 202.153.48.24 202.90.235.41 118.67.112.81